'P' and 'Q' can complete a task in 36 days together. If
'P' alone can do it in 60 days, how long would 'Q' take to finish the task alone?Solution
ATQ,
Let the total work be 180 units. {LCM (36 and 60)} So, combined efficiency of 'P' and 'Q' = 180 ÷ 36 = 5 units/day Efficiency of 'P' = 180 ÷ 60 = 3 units/day So, efficiency of 'Q' = 5 - 3 = 2 units/day So, time taken by 'Q' to do the work alone = 180 ÷ 2 = 90 days
